<strong>Sydney</strong> <strong>Opera</strong> <strong>House</strong><strong>Event</strong> <strong>Carbon</strong> <strong>Counter</strong> <strong>Template</strong>Electricity Emissions CalculationsOverviewElectricity emissions are likely to be a major source of emissions for events.Electricity consumption data is available from various sub-meters.Electricity volume can be directly converted into equivalent emission using the appropriate emissions factor for the state.Electricity usage information is entered into the blue cells belowUser noteInput Cells are blue1. Emissions factor source & descriptionEmissions factors for electricity emissions are from Australian Government, Department of Climate Change and Energy Efficiency, National Greenhouse Accounts (NGA) Factors, July 2010www.climatechange.gov.au/publications/greenhouse-acctg/national-greenhouse-factors.aspxRef: NGA factors 2010, Table 40, Full fuel cycle EF (EF for Scope 2 & EF for Scope 3), NSWNB. Applies to NSW events only, there are different emissions factors for other states3. Data Quality & LimitationsMeter data used for general, light and power. AC calculation based previous calculations of each venue at 7 Litres of outside air per seat for sold out venue. Bump In/Out assumption minimum 2 hours prior and 1 hour post, unless conflicts with an event prior or post. Bump In/Out assumption for Concert Hall and <strong>Opera</strong> Theatre minimum 4 hours prior and 1 hour post, unless conflicts with an event prior or post. RRMA has no metering available, however as this is a room with only fluorescent lighting an assumption has been made that consumption is 40 kw phEnergy consumption includes a 20% contingency for purposes of conservatism5. Supporting DetailsWe hope that this template is a helpful starting point for others in event carbon calculations.
